Jean-Claude Bouchet (born May 2,1957 in Cavaillon,Vaucluse) is a French politician of the Republicans (LR) who has been serving as a member of the National Assembly of France since the 2007 elections. [1] He represents the Vaucluse department,and is a member . [1]
In Parliament,Bouchet serves on the Committee on Foreign Affairs. [2]
In the Republicans’2016 presidential primaries,Bouchet endorsed Jean-François Copé as the party's candidate for the office of President of France. [3] In the Republicans’2017 leadership election,he endorsed Laurent Wauquiez. [4]
In July 2019,Bouchet voted against the French ratification of the European Union’s Comprehensive Economic and Trade Agreement (CETA) with Canada. [5]
